Sets of bounded remainder for the continuous irrational rotation on $[0,1)^2$

Abstract
We study sets of bounded remainder for the two-dimensional continuous irrational rotation in the unit square. In particular, we show that for almost all and every starting point , every polygon with no edge of slope is a set of bounded remainder. Moreover, every convex set whose boundary is twice continuously differentiable with positive curvature at every point is a bounded remainder set for almost all and every starting point . Finally we show that these assertions are, in some sense, best possible.
